Chapter Thirty-OneArriving at Deep Water's cabin, White Dove took the horses to the little outhouse with its open front and roof of tarpaulin at the rear, whilst the men went inside, Simms to stock up the fire and Deep Water to bathe his wounded thigh. Outside, as she unbuckled the saddles and laid them across a rail, White Dove stopped at the approach of the other woman. She smiled. “My name is Melody,” said the woman, stepping up close. “I never got the chance to thank you.” “I did not do so very much.” “You saved us from those awful savages and…” She stopped, noticing White Dove's dark stare. “I'm sorry, I didn't mean—” “Many people believe all Natives are savages.
